蒸気の処理装置。 In the fuel vapor processing device in which fuel vapor during refueling is adsorbed to a carbon canister by a second ventilation passage having a valve that is opened and closed by inserting and extracting a refueling nozzle in the upper space of the fuel tank, the second bench A valve body is disposed outside the fuel tank in the middle of the ventilation passageway and has a tapered seat surface facing the float, and the float accommodation chamber forms part of the second ventilation passageway. A fuel vapor processing device in a fuel tank, characterized in that a front passage is connected to the fuel tank, and a return passage is connected to an inlet pipe of the tank.
